Voice Search and Conversational Marketing Will Grow

With the rise of smart assistants like Alexa and Google Assistant, voice search is becoming more prevalent. Businesses must optimize their content for voice queries by:

  • Using conversational and long-tail keywords.
  • Structuring content in a question-answer format.
  • Enhancing local SEO strategies for "near me" searches.

Privacy and Data Protection Will Reshape Marketing

With increasing data privacy regulations (like GDPR and CCPA) and the phasing out of third-party cookies, businesses must adapt by:

  • Prioritizing first-party data collection.
  • Using AI-driven predictive analytics instead of relying on cookies.
  • Enhancing transparency in data usage to build consumer trust.
